Netflix's Sarandos to testify in Senate hearing on Warner deal, Bloomberg News reports
Jan 22 (Reuters) - Netflix co-CEO Ted Sarandos is planning to testify in February at a U.S. Senate committee hearing looking into the company's proposed $82.7 billion purchase of the streaming and studio operations of Warner Bros Discovery Inc, Bloomberg News reported on Thursday.
